Output 2140fc513223d153da55a94bfe68f1d76be41f8a91fd2cdc2d1eccc388796913:4

value
430641
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fbbf576e295a11c4bee3a75e1b93425592bfe06 OP_EQUALVERIFY OP_CHECKSIG
address
18GbYmKWqtZJbcW3LWngJ3fVVyJMfeeFoq
transaction
2140fc513223d153da55a94bfe68f1d76be41f8a91fd2cdc2d1eccc388796913
spent
true